The National Flu Line can not issue medical certificates
Med 3 - only use this if you have examined the patient on the day of issue or day before.
The Department of Health is looking at it being possible to issue Med 3s after a telephone consultation only. If you do this please annotate the certificate clearly to this effect
Med 5 - you could use this without seeing the patient if you have evidence of your patient having been seen at Out of Hours or by another doctor.
Self certificates
These cover the first week of sickness leave and is designed to minimise the workload on GPs and Health Services from minor, self limiting conditions.
The employer can allow an extension on the period of self-certification e.g. 10 days during a flu pandemic when their employee has flu like symptoms. If they have access to occupational health then they can use these resources to evidence additional time off.
